PILOT (36IRB/C36IRB)
Shut off the gas before servicing the
unit.
All gas joints disturbed during
servicing must be checked for leaks. Check with a
soap and water solution (bubbles). Do not use an open
flame.
1. Remove
MANIFOLD COVER, LEFT SIDE
PANEL if replacing left pilot and RIGHT SIDE
PANEL if replacing right pilot.
2. From inside the broiler cooking area, disconnect
compression fitting from the pilot.
When disconnecting compression fitting
for the pilot, support bracket to prevent bending.
Fig. 20
3. Remove screws securing pilot and bracket to the
broiler.
